Removed from homepage – excitement over scary video involving guns at school

The article on the homepage of HAK Zwei in Salzburg, where partly masked students coolly pose with pistols, was only recently online. There is a lot of criticism about the handling of the extremely sensitive subject of weapons. The director explains the background.

What are weapons and masked faces doing on a school website? Everyone who opened the homepage of HAK Zwei in Salzburg on Thursday could not believe their eyes. Right on the homepage, masked students coolly posed with various weapons. In the middle of the group, the class teacher also seemed relaxed and youthful. No explanation was given as to how the subject was treated so thoughtlessly. The post only had the title with the short comment “Class photo.”

No one here should have realized how sensitive the subject of ‘guns in schools’ is. The Education Directorate has ordered the video to be removed again.

Students wanted to stand out in the photo shoot
Director Daniela Huber-Krimplstätter was away at a conference at the time. She says somewhat regretfully about the background of the photo campaign: “The students just wanted to look cool and stand out in a graduation photo.” But the campaign went completely wrong. The teacher involved should have stopped the students in their ideas.

According to Huber-Krimplstätter, internal school quality standards for publication on the school website were also circumvented. An illuminating conversation has already taken place: “The colleague has made a mistake here that should not happen this way.”
